Scoil an Chroí Naofa is a Catholic school under the patronage of Bishop Michael Duignan of Clonfert.
We are a mixed school from Junior Infants to 6th class with a Special Class for children with autism and 2 Special Classes for children with Developmental Language Delay. We have 13 mainstream teachers, 14 Special Education teachers and 7 Special Needs Assistants.
Located in the centre of Ballinasloe town, Scoil an Chroi Naofa is a DEIS Band 1 school which means we are fortunate to have a lower pupil/teacher ratio of 22:1 as well as lots of additional programmes available in the school such as breakfast club, school lunches, homework club, summer programmes and a Home School Community Liaison teacher.
Scoil an Chroí Naofa is an inclusive school and we welcome all children.
